Looking at the code, all the plug-in does is tell macOS to open a URL like addressbook://<Contact ID>, so what happens (or used to happen) is entirely up to the system.
According to the docs, there doesn’t seem to be a way to specify anything about window behavior.
For what it’s worth, if you don’t have the Contacts app already running, you’ll get the normal full view when you open a contact. I never knew about the second window because I never leave it running.
